Transaction 3573ae85e084f41d3ec71daabdb2c103a0ba447fb0b27bb18cd70de75ecb4b92

5 Input
1 Outputs
  • 3573ae85e084f41d3ec71daabdb2c103a0ba447fb0b27bb18cd70de75ecb4b92:0
  • value  3085209
    address  12EWNRxxzXoEAHkDaVhUqeDF5RzZ1cKEFo